eBay

MTS2, Software Engineer- Live Commerce

Shanghai, China
Kotlin API Spring GraphQL Git Java
Description

At eBay, we're more than a global ecommerce leader — we’re changing the way the world shops and sells. Our platform empowers millions of buyers and sellers in more than 190 markets around the world. We’re committed to pushing boundaries and leaving our mark as we reinvent the future of ecommerce for enthusiasts.

Our customers are our compass, authenticity thrives, bold ideas are welcome, and everyone can bring their unique selves to work — every day. We're in this together, sustaining the future of our customers, our company, and our planet.

Join a team of passionate thinkers, innovators, and dreamers — and help us connect people and build communities to create economic opportunity for all.

eBay is a global commerce leader that allows you to shape how the world buys, sells, and gives. You’ll be part of a work culture that’s been genuinely committed to diversity and inclusion since its founding 25 years ago. We are looking for people with drive, ideas, and a passion for helping small businesses succeed to help shape the future of eBay—does this sound like you? If so, we’d love to talk to you!

About the team:
Core Technology (CT) is a global team responsible for the end-to-end eBay technology platform. This platform runs our entire infrastructure and all the services that come together to form ebay.com. You will be part of an agile Content Platform team, which is responsible for cutting edge development in eBay Live.

eBay is looking to hire a passionate, collaborative and motivated Backend Software Engineer to work in eBay Live, While this type of real-time platform has gained broad acceptance in APAC, the adoption of live shopping in the Americas and EMEA is still relatively low, and we’re working to be the platform of choice for this emerging trend. 
You can read about some of the cool projects the team is working on:
eBay Launches Live Shopping for Collectibles

Responsibilities:

  • You will be a member of our Core AI Engineering team, building eBay Live.
  • Collaborate closely with peers, Architects, Product Managers, Business Analysts, Quality Engineers, and Operations teams to develop innovative solutions that meet functional and non-functional standards and expectations.
  • Be involved in development, testing, release, triage, bug fix, documentation, and work in an Agile environment. Use of tools like JIRA, Git, CICD and other internal eBay tools on a regular basis to organize work and deliver features.
  • Participate in technical design and code reviews and provide feedback to other engineers on the team.
  • Deliver highly performing, low latency, robust code with high test case coverage, continuous integration and production monitoring
  • Triage and debug production issues
  • Mentor junior team members

Job Requirements:

  • BS/BA in Computer Science or related field plus 10 years work experience or MS with 8 years of relevant experience
  • Strong experience with JVM languages (Java, Kotlin)
  • Experience in building large, reliable, scalable distributed systems
  • Experience with building event-driven applications
  • Experience with designing and building RESTful APIs with Spring Boot
  • Excellent communication and lead skills to be able work and collaborate with other teams involved in our projects.
  • Hands on experience with: GraphQL
  • Prove experience in architecting backend systems
  • Deep understanding of design patterns, and experience working in a layered architecture
  • Knowledge of core CS concepts such as common data structures and algorithms
  • Experience with modern DevOps principles and continuous delivery
  • Work closely w/ colleagues and customers in different functional groups and remote offices
  • Past experience with Live Commerce or Live Stream or Websocket is big PLUS.

Disclaimer: Please note that by applying to this role, you are agreeing to be considered for multiple positions. This is a general description of the qualifications and skills required for positions of this type of role.

Please see the Talent Privacy Notice for information regarding how eBay handles your personal data collected when you use the eBay Careers website or apply for a job with eBay.

eBay is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, sex, sexual orientation, gender identity, veteran status, and disability, or other legally protected status. If you have a need that requires accommodation, please contact us at talent@ebay.com. We will make every effort to respond to your request for accommodation as soon as possible. View our accessibility statement to learn more about eBay's commitment to ensuring digital accessibility for people with disabilities.

Jobs posted with location as "Remote - United States (Excludes: HI, NM)" excludes residents of Hawaii and New Mexico.

 

This website uses cookies to enhance your experience. By continuing to browse the site, you agree to our use of cookies. Visit our Privacy Center for more information.

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

50,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 241 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

Cancel anytime / Money-back guarantee

Wall of love from fellow engineers